About this property

Resting on a quiet side road in the coastal town of Hunstanton is this delightful Victorian town house traditionally built in beautiful carr stone and well-presented throughout. This lovely property set over three floors plays host to five bedrooms ideally suited to families and friends looking to discover the vibrant region of East Anglia. Step into the large hallway and make your way through to the sitting room which is beautifully presented with sumptuous sofas, modern furnishings and a lovely bay window drawing in plenty of light. This along with the dining room next door has the option to present an open-plan interior space with double doors adjoining the two.

The kitchen also benefits from an extra dining area and features an ultra-modern set-up and patio doors leading outdoors. The second floor comprises a family bathroom, a children's bunk room and a twin with an interlinking double, perfect for a family of four. Glide on up to the third floor where you will find another double room and bathroom with sink and WC next door. The garden is the perfect little haven to relax and unwind on the decking under the shaded trees. The kids can immerse themselves in an exciting game of hide-and-seek through the enchanting alcoves of wildlife while you sit out in the opening, a delightful little suntrap with seating for you to enjoy a glass of refreshing wine.

With just a 5 minute walk to the beach, this cottage is in a superb location for exploring the Norfolk Coast in an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ty. There are so many attractions available in the nearby towns of King's Lynn, Norwich and The Broads, and the local town of Hunstanton offers a promenade along the seafront with funfair rides, candyfloss stalls and much more for the kids to enjoy. Explore what East Anglia has to offer from this heart-warming town house.

The coastal town of Hunstanton is located on the Western side of the East Norfolk Coastline. The seafront with promenade offers rock and candyfloss stalls, funfair rides, a sealife sanctuary, bowls, golfing, a leisure centre, pitch-and-putt, Esplanade gardens, theatre, clean sandy beaches, donkey rides and sea tours in an amphibious craft. On Sunday afternoons a band often plays in the bandstand on the green overlooking the beach while throughout the year additional events are held within the town. The beach at Old Hunstanton is popular with sunbathers, and also with wind and kite surfers.
